ClusterHealthChunkQueryDescription
A descrição da consulta de parte de integridade do cluster, que pode especificar as políticas de integridade para avaliar a integridade do cluster e filtros muito expressivos para selecionar quais entidades de cluster incluir em resposta.
Propriedades
Nome | Type | Obrigatório |
---|---|---|
NodeFilters |
matriz de NodeHealthStateFilter | Não |
ApplicationFilters |
matriz de ApplicationHealthStateFilter | Não |
ClusterHealthPolicy |
ClusterHealthPolicy | Não |
ApplicationHealthPolicies |
ApplicationHealthPolicies | Não |
NodeFilters
Tipo: matriz de NodeHealthStateFilter
Obrigatório: não
Define uma lista de filtros que especificam quais nós serão incluídos na parte de integridade do cluster retornada.
Se nenhum filtro for especificado, nenhum nó será retornado. Todos os nós são usados para avaliar o estado de integridade agregado do cluster, independentemente dos filtros de entrada.
A consulta de parte de integridade do cluster pode especificar vários filtros de nó.
Por exemplo, ele pode especificar um filtro para retornar todos os nós com o estado de integridade Error e outro filtro para sempre incluir um nó identificado por seu NodeName.
ApplicationFilters
Tipo: matriz de ApplicationHealthStateFilter
Obrigatório: não
Define uma lista de filtros que especificam quais aplicativos serão incluídos na parte de integridade do cluster retornada.
Se nenhum filtro for especificado, nenhum aplicativo será retornado. Todos os aplicativos são usados para avaliar o estado de integridade agregado do cluster, independentemente dos filtros de entrada.
A consulta de parte de integridade do cluster pode especificar vários filtros de aplicativo.
Por exemplo, ele pode especificar um filtro para retornar todos os aplicativos com o estado de integridade Error e outro filtro para sempre incluir aplicativos de um tipo de aplicativo especificado.
ClusterHealthPolicy
Tipo: ClusterHealthPolicy
Obrigatório: não
Define uma política de integridade usada para avaliar a integridade do cluster ou de um nó de cluster.
ApplicationHealthPolicies
Tipo: ApplicationHealthPolicies
Obrigatório: não
Define o mapa da política de integridade do aplicativo usado para avaliar a integridade de um aplicativo ou de uma de suas entidades filho.